Skip to main content

Synway SMG Gateway CVE-2025-71284

| EUVD-2025-209597 CRITICAL
OS Command Injection (CWE-78)
2026-04-30 VulnCheck
9.3
CVSS 4.0
Share

CVSS VectorNVD

CVSS:4.0/AV:N/AC:L/AT:N/PR:N/UI:N/VC:H/VI:H/VA:H/SC:N/SI:N/SA:N/E:X/CR:X/IR:X/AR:X/MAV:X/MAC:X/MAT:X/MPR:X/MUI:X/MVC:X/MVI:X/MVA:X/MSC:X/MSI:X/MSA:X/S:X/AU:X/R:X/V:X/RE:X/U:X
Attack Vector
Network
Attack Complexity
Low
Privileges Required
None
User Interaction
None
Scope
X

Lifecycle Timeline

6
Analysis Generated
Apr 30, 2026 - 17:30 vuln.today
CVSS changed
Apr 30, 2026 - 17:22 NVD
9.8 (CRITICAL) 9.3 (CRITICAL)
PoC Detected
Apr 30, 2026 - 17:20 vuln.today
Public exploit code
EUVD ID Assigned
Apr 30, 2026 - 17:00 euvd
EUVD-2025-209597
Analysis Generated
Apr 30, 2026 - 17:00 vuln.today
CVE Published
Apr 30, 2026 - 16:08 nvd
CRITICAL 9.3

DescriptionNVD

Synway SMG Gateway Management Software contains an OS command injection vulnerability in the RADIUS configuration endpoint at /en/9-2radius.php where the radius_address POST parameter is split and interpolated directly into a sed command without sanitization. An unauthenticated remote attacker can inject arbitrary shell commands by submitting a POST request with crafted radius_address, radius_address2, shared_secret2, source_ip, timeout, or retry parameters along with save=1 and enable_radius=1 to achieve remote code execution. Exploitation evidence was first observed by the Shadowserver Foundation on 2025-07-11 (UTC).

AnalysisAI

Remote code execution in Synway SMG Gateway Management Software allows unauthenticated attackers to execute arbitrary OS commands via command injection in the RADIUS configuration endpoint. The vulnerability exploits unsanitized POST parameters (radius_address, radius_address2, shared_secret2, source_ip, timeout, retry) that are directly interpolated into sed commands at /en/9-2radius.php. Shadowserver Foundation confirmed active exploitation beginning July 11, 2025, with publicly available exploit code and Nuclei templates enabling widespread automated attacks. CVSS 9.3 critical severity reflects the combination of network accessibility, zero authentication requirements, and complete system compromise potential.

Technical ContextAI

The vulnerability exists in the RADIUS authentication configuration module of Synway SMG Gateway Management Software, specifically at the /en/9-2radius.php endpoint. This is a classic OS command injection (CWE-78) where user-supplied input from POST parameters is passed unsanitized to the sed stream editor command in a shell context. The PHP application splits the radius_address parameter and directly interpolates it into a sed command without proper escaping or validation. When combined with save=1 and enable_radius=1 parameters, the crafted input executes in the underlying operating system shell with the privileges of the web server process. The CPE identifier (cpe:2.3:a:synway_information_engineering_co.,_ltd.:synway_smg_gateway_management_software) indicates this affects Synway's gateway management platform used for Session Management Gateway and telecommunications applications.

RemediationAI

No vendor-released patch or security advisory has been identified from Synway Information Engineering at time of analysis despite confirmed active exploitation since July 2025. Organizations must implement immediate compensating controls: (1) Block external access to the management interface at /en/9-2radius.php and all administrative endpoints, restricting access only from trusted management networks via firewall rules or reverse proxy ACLs - this prevents unauthenticated remote exploitation but does not address insider threats or compromised management networks; (2) Deploy web application firewall (WAF) rules to detect and block command injection patterns in POST parameters radius_address, radius_address2, shared_secret2, source_ip, timeout, and retry, specifically monitoring for shell metacharacters (semicolons, pipes, backticks, dollar signs) - note that sophisticated attackers may bypass signature-based detection; (3) If RADIUS authentication is not operationally required, disable the RADIUS configuration module entirely and remove /en/9-2radius.php from the web root; (4) Implement network segmentation to isolate Synway SMG gateways from critical infrastructure and enforce strict egress filtering to prevent command-and-control communications. Monitor Synway's official site (https://www.synway.net/) and VulnCheck advisory for vendor patch releases. Given the telecommunications infrastructure role of these devices, coordinate remediation with change management to avoid service disruption while prioritizing security.

Share

CVE-2025-71284 vulnerability details – vuln.today

This site uses cookies essential for authentication and security. No tracking or analytics cookies are used. Privacy Policy